What is Hereditary Engineering?

Gene therapy constitutes a biomedical treatment that focuses on adjusting a subject’s genetic sequence to manage or halt health conditions. This is executed through different mechanisms, including:

Gene Replacement Therapy – Transferring a active hereditary component to exchange a malfunctioning or deficient one.

Genetic Suppression – Blocking the operation of deleterious DNA sequences. Hereditary Alteration – Meticulously adjusting the hereditary sequence using genomic editing systems like genetic reprogramming. Genetic Cell Therapy – Transforming living components ex vivo and grafting them within the biological system.

This pioneering discipline has progressed rapidly with the evolution of biotechnology, opening up pathways to cure medical issues once thought to be irreversible.

Biological Delivery Systems

Microbes have developed to precisely deliver genetic material into recipient cells, establishing them as a viable method for genetic modification. Widely used viral vectors include:

Adenoviruses – Capable of infecting both dividing and static cells but can elicit immunogenic reactions.

AAV vectors – Highly regarded due to their reduced immune response and ability to sustain prolonged genetic activity.

Retroviruses and Lentiviruses – Incorporate into the host genome, providing stable gene expression, with lentiviruses being particularly beneficial for targeting non-dividing cells.

Alternative Genetic Delivery Methods

Non-viral delivery methods present a less immunogenic choice, minimizing host rejection. These include:

Lipid-based carriers and nano-delivery systems – Encapsulating genetic sequences for efficient intracellular transport.

Electroporation – Applying electric shocks to create temporary pores in plasma barriers, allowing genetic material to enter.

Intramuscular Gene Delivery – Delivering nucleic acids precisely into target tissues.

Medical Uses of Genetic Modification

DNA-based interventions have proven effective across multiple medical fields, notably transforming the treatment of hereditary diseases, malignancies, and infectious diseases.

Addressing Inherited Diseases

Various hereditary diseases result from isolated genetic anomalies, making them ideal candidates for genetic correction. Several breakthroughs include:

CFTR Mutation Disorder – Studies focusing on delivering working CFTR sequences are showing promising results.

Hemophilia – Gene therapy trials seek to reestablish the biosynthesis of coagulation proteins.

Muscular Dystrophy – CRISPR-driven genetic correction offers hope for individuals with DMD.

Sickle Cell Disease and Beta-Thalassemia – Gene therapy strategies seek to repair oxygen transport mutations.

DNA-Based Oncology Solutions

DNA-based interventions are crucial in cancer treatment, either by modifying immune cells to recognize and attack tumors or by directly altering cancerous cells to halt metastasis. Key innovative tumor-targeted genetic solutions consist of:

CAR-T Cell Therapy – Genetically engineered T cells targeting specific cancer antigens.

Cancer-Selective Viral Agents – Genetically modified pathogens that specifically target and eradicate cancerous growths.

Reactivation of Oncogene Inhibitors – Reviving the activity of genes like TP53 to maintain cellular balance.


Remedy of Pathogenic Conditions

Gene therapy unveils plausible solutions for ongoing diseases notably HIV/AIDS. Developmental approaches encompass:

CRISPR-driven Antiviral Therapy – Focusing on and destroying viral-laden organisms.

Genetic Engineering of Immune Cells – Rendering White blood cells defensive to viral invasion.

Unraveling the Science of Advanced Genetic and Cellular Treatments

Cellular Treatments: The Power of Live Cell Applications

Cell therapy harnesses the restoration capabilities of cellular functions to address health conditions. Significant therapies comprise:

Advanced Stem Cell Replacement:
Used to address malignancies and blood-related diseases through regenerative transplantation using viable donor cells.

CAR-T Cell Therapy: A groundbreaking cancer treatment in which a patient’s lymphocytes are tailored to target with precision and neutralize malignant cells.

MSC Therapy: Explored for its clinical applications in counteracting autoimmune-related illnesses, skeletal trauma, and brain-related conditions.

Gene Therapy: Editing the Human DNA

Gene therapy functions through directly targeting the genetic basis of hereditary conditions:

In Vivo Gene Therapy: Administers DNA sequences inside the individual’s system, such as the regulatory-approved vision-restoring Luxturna for curing genetic eye conditions.

Ex Vivo Gene Therapy: Requires modifying a subject’s genetic material outside the body and then implanting them, as applied in some research-based therapies for hemoglobinopathy conditions and immune deficiencies.

The advent of gene-editing CRISPR has rapidly progressed gene therapy scientific exploration, making possible precise check my blog modifications at the genetic scale.

Revolutionary Impacts in Therapeutics

Cell and gene therapies are advancing treatment paradigms in various specialties:

Oncology Solutions

The authorization of T-cell immunotherapy like Kymriah and Gilead’s Yescarta has redefined the malignancy-fighting methods, with significant impact on those with specific leukemia forms who have not responded to conventional therapies.

Hereditary Conditions

Conditions for instance a genetic neuromuscular disorder as well as sickle cell disease, that in the past had restricted care possibilities, as of today have promising genomic medicine strategies such as a gene replacement therapy as well as Casgevy.
